GP3 - Alexander Rossi Leads the Way with ART Grand Prix rticle
Le Castellet, France - March 7, 2010 - California native, Alexander Rossi, joined 33 drivers, representing 20 countries, over two days at the famed Paul Ricard test circuit for the first official and inaugural test of the GP3 Championship Series. Running on the "3D" track configuration, in both wet and dry conditions, the 3.853 KM layout uses a section of the famous Mistral straight going into the Signes corner. Rossi led the way giving notice of his intent for the 2010 season, after having signed for GP3 Championship with multi championship winning team, ART Grand Prix this past January. The 18 year old, Rossi set the fastest overall time at 1:20.013 and lead the time charts in three of the four sessions.

Rossi Tops Leaderboard in First GP3 Test
Le Castellet, France - America's Alexander Rossi came out on top of the first GP3 group test session at Paul Ricard, in preparation for the inaugural season of the latest F1 ladder series. Rossi not only set the quickest time of the week, but also headed three of the four sessions held for the 280hp Renault-powered spec Dallara chassis.

Rossi Endures Bahrain Debut
Bahrain International Circuit, Bahrain - March 2, 2010  With preparations already underway for the Formula 1 season opener, March 12-14, GP2 Asia held race 5 and 6 this past weekend at the Bahrain International Circuit (BIC), built in 2003. Entering the weekend 3rd in championship points, Malaysia Qi MeritusMahara driver, Alexander Rossi, had high hopes of his debut on the 6.3 kilometer circuit, as he was anxious to put to use the time spent preparing in a U.K. simulator the week previous and looking to gain valuable points and data leading up to the series season finale serving as support to Formula 1.

OVERCOMING ADVERSITY AT 'YAS' - ROSSI 3RD IN GP2 ASIA CHAMPIONSHIP STANDINGS
Abu Dhabi, United Arab Emirates  February 9, 2010 - Alexander Rossi returned to the Yas Marina Circuit in Abu Dhabi this past weekend to race under the lights for round two of the GP2 Asia Series. The event marked Rossi's race debut for team MalaysiaQI-MeritusMahara. Despite an adversity filled weekend at 'Yas', Rossi and Meritus collected valuable championship points, exiting the weekend with Rossi now 3rd in the driver's standings as GP2 Asia heads to the Bahrain International Circuit later this month. Rossi was pleased with his Meritus entry from the outset, qualifying 5th just 3/10ths shy of pole. However, a technical infraction with a setting on the rear wing element was assessed by the FIA stewards after the session resulting in Rossi being relegated to 24th on grid for race one.

Alexander Rossi's Qualifying Fast Times in Abu Dhabi are Disallowed
Alexander Rossi qualified 5th, posting a 1:52.861 for Team MalaysiaQi-Meritus, missing pole by 3/10ths for Round 2 in Abu Dhabi. HOWEVER, Rossi's 3rd row starting position was short lived, lacking celebration, when the FIA officials found the #21 piloted by Rossi out of compliance for a team technical violation on a rear wing setting. Due to the technical infraction, Rossi was relegated to start 24th for Race 1 on Friday next to his teammate, Luca Filippi who had his own misfortune lining up 23rd. Alexander Rossi Quote: "I was pleased with the car and the pace we had today", Rossi said. "As normal in GP2, clean laps are hard to find but lining up P5 I felt we had a clean shot for a win today. Being disqualified for a technical violation is frustrating and definitely changes the scenery starting from the rear of the grid. I will make the most of racing from the back, but it poses a different strategy versus starting from the third row. The car is really good and I'm confident in my own ability to gain track position. If we have a good opening laps and a clean pit stop anything can happen." Peter Thompson Quote: "We proved today that we had the pace", Peter Thompson commented. "Unfortunately we had technical problems and human error by the team that was simply unacceptable. The drivers now have a big task in today's race, but each believe they have the car and the pace to aim for a top-8 result." FULL PRESS RELEASE TO FOLLOW COMPLETION OF ABU DHABI RACE EVENT.

ROSSI SIGNS with MERITUS for GP2 ASIA SERIES
Dubai, United Arab Emirates - January 27, 2010 - Alexander Rossi will contest the remaining rounds of the GP2 Asia Series with the championship winning team, Malaysia-QI-Meritus. The arrangement will partner 18-year-old American with former GP2 race winner Luca Filippi, as Alexander looks forward to a strong finish to the championship. "I want to thank Peter Thompson, President and team founder of MalaysiaQI-MeritusMaharaGP.com and its chairman Raad S. Abduljawad for giving me the chance to compete for the rest of the season", Rossi commented. "I am very confident in the teams abilities to prepare a race winning car and I am looking forward to getting back to work in Abu Dhabi. My goals are simple - 'to win' and I feel that I can deliver on this ambition as this team is one of continual strength and determination."

ROSSI SIGNS WITH ART Grand Prix
Nevada City, California, January 19, 2010 - Alexander Rossi will contest GP3 Series in 2010, driving for the prestigious ART Grand Prix team. The arrangement will see the 18-year-old American racing at eight venues in 2010, including seven with Formula 1, beginning at the Spanish Grand Prix in Barcelona on May 9th.
